
Gateway Board of Directors Holds Retreat
The 10-member Gateway Community & Technical College Board of Directors and College
President Dr. Ed Hughes held an informational retreat on January 9 and 10 facilitated
by Dr. Pamela Fisher of the Association of Community College Trustees. It focused
on learning about best practices used by high performing boards and presidents across
the nation. Discussions were held about Gateway's students and the variety of college
programs and services provided to students in order to assist them. The board members
reviewed the challenges and opportunities for the future and its roles in providing
leadership, guidance and assistance to Gateway. They praised the work of the faculty
and staff and voiced appreciation for the leadership team who made presentations during
the retreat.
Chairman Jeff Groob stated, The board and the president are on the same page and are
working together. We have a collective focus on removing barriers to enrollment and
student success at Gateway. We will reach out to community partners who can provide
help for our students. On behalf of the Board I want everyone to know that we are
committed to do our part to advocate for and advance the institution to the next level.
